DAX Futures Updates

The DAX 40 declined approximately 0.7% to roughly 23,390 on Monday, concluding a four-day ascent that had propelled the index to unprecedented levels the previous week, while lagging behind its European counterparts.

Renewed US-Iran strikes in the Middle East, coupled with a hawkish inflation stance articulated by Federal Reserve Chair Kevin Warsh during his Friday speech at Jackson Hole, have negatively impacted market sentiment, resulting in an uptick in oil prices and bond yields. Today, attention was directed toward the release of inflation data.

Most sectors experienced declines, with industrials at the forefront. Siemens Energy experienced the most significant decline among stocks, decreasing by more than 4%, while MTU Aero Engines and Heidelberg Materials also saw reductions exceeding 1% each.
